// Quick note for the eng sync: exports to the Corvette warehouse flake
// roughly 2% of the time, usually on Larkfield's nightly window. We retry
// with jittered backoff instead of fixed delays now, which dropped the
// manual-requeue count to near zero. Tune this cap carefully — five was
// picked from the Brindle incident data. The baseline build token appears below.

build token for kagaf-hahof: htk14_9d3d4d26d7d8de

Confirm that the DeployBot chat integration posts deploy status to the #releases channel within 30 seconds of pipeline completion. Verify both success and rollback messages render correctly, including the environment tag and commit summary. Marta has tested staging; production verification is still pending and owned by the platform pod. Once the final smoke test passes, record the build that DeployBot announced so we can cross-check against the pipeline logs. The token from that announcement is below.

pipeline stamp: htk31_f769b577b3028a4e9958e5bb8d1259a

Subject: Quickstore 4.2 — bloom filter now fronts the KV layer

Plugin authors: starting with this release, Quickstore places a bloom filter ahead of the key-value store. Negative lookups return faster; false positives fall through safely. No API changes are required on your side. Verify your plugin against the staging build referenced below.

session token of fahif-tadup = htk3_9c7

**Action item (INC-Brindlewood):** Add input-size guards to the Quillfeather markdown renderer before sanitization runs. The outage occurred because deeply nested blockquotes caused unbounded recursion in the preview service, exhausting worker memory. New team members should note that rendering limits live in config, not code, and must be changed via reviewed deploys. The limit rationale and tuning history are recorded on the internal page.

runbook for badug-kadup: https://confluence.zemvarlabs.internal/projects/browse/display/projects/bd1b